SLOPE ROTATABILITY OF ICOSAHEDRON AND DODECAHEDRON DESIGNS

  • Kim Hyuk-Joo;Park Sung-Hyun
    • Journal of the Korean Statistical Society
    • /
    • 제35권1호
    • /
    • pp.25-36
    • /
    • 2006
  • Icosahedron and dodecahedron designs are experimental designs which can be used for response surface analysis for the case when three independent variables are involved. When we are interested in estimating the slope of a response surface, slope rot at ability is a desirable property. In this paper, we derive conditions for icosahedron and dodecahedron designs to have slope rotatability, and actually obtain some slope-rotatable icosahedron and dodecahedron designs. We also apply Park and Kim (1992)'s measure of slope rotatability to icosahedron and dodecahedron designs, and observe resultant facts.

Discontinuous finite-element quadrature sets based on icosahedron for the discrete ordinates method

  • Dai, Ni;Zhang, Bin;Chen, Yixue
    • Nuclear Engineering and Technology
    • /
    • 제52권6호
    • /
    • pp.1137-1147
    • /
    • 2020
  • The discrete ordinates method (SN) is one of the major shielding calculation method, which is suitable for solving deep-penetration transport problems. Our objective is to explore the available quadrature sets and to improve the accuracy in shielding problems involving strong anisotropy. The linear discontinuous finite-element (LDFE) quadrature sets based on the icosahedron (in short, ICLDFE quadrature sets) are developed by defining projected points on the surfaces of the icosahedron. Weights are then introduced in the integration of the discontinuous finite-element basis functions in the relevant angular regions. The multivariate secant method is used to optimize the discrete directions and their corresponding weights. The numerical integration of polynomials in the direction cosines and the Kobayashi benchmark are used to analyze and verify the properties of these new quadrature sets. Results show that the ICLDFE quadrature sets can exactly integrate the zero-order and first-order of the spherical harmonic functions over one-twentieth of the spherical surface. As for the Kobayashi benchmark problem, the maximum relative error between the fifth-order ICLDFE quadrature sets and references is only -0.55%. The ICLDFE quadrature sets provide better integration precision of the spherical harmonic functions in local discrete angle domains and higher accuracy for simple shielding problems.

정20면체 모듈러 돔의 형상모델링 및 구조안정성에 관한 연구 (A Study on the Shape Modeling and Structural Stability of an Icosahedron-typed Modular Dome)

  • 손수덕;우효준;이승재
    • 한국공간구조학회논문집
    • /
    • 제15권2호
    • /
    • pp.51-59
    • /
    • 2015
  • In this study, a shape design and an analysis considering structural stability were investigated to develop an icosahedron-based hemispherical modular dome. To design this modular dome, a program that can perform icosahedron shape modeling, modularization of joint connection members, and the analysis of structural stability was developed. Furthermore, based on the adopted numerical model, the eigen buckling mode, unstable behavior characteristics according to load vector, and the critical buckling load of the modular dome under uniformly distributed load and concentrated load were analyzed, and the resistance capacities of the structure according to different load vectors were compared. The analysis results for the modular dome suggest that the developed program can perform joint modeling for shape design as well as modular member design, and adequately expressed the nonlinear behaviors of structured according to load conditions. The critical buckling load results also correctly reflected the characteristics of the load conditions. The uniformly distributed load was more advantageous to the structural stability than concentrated load.

Molecular Dynamics Simulations on Melting Properties of Free Icosahedral Copper Clusters

  • Kang, Jeong-Won;Hwang, Ho-Jung
    • Transactions on Electrical and Electronic Materials
    • /
    • 제4권1호
    • /
    • pp.1-6
    • /
    • 2003
  • We have studied the size confinement effect on the properties of melting-like transition of small icosahedral copper clusters using a classical molecular dynamics simulation based on a well fitted empirical potential. We investigated the caloric curves of icosahedron nanoclusters and the significant depression in the melting temperatures of the copper nanoclusters was compared with that of the bulk copper. A structural transitions from decahedral to icosahedral shapes were shown. As the cluster size increased, the melting temperature increased, and the latent heat increased but seem to be saturated. However, the specific heat was unrelated to the cluster size.

정20면체기반 반구형 돔의 일사량과 효율적인 솔라패널에 관한 연구 (A Study on Solar Radiation and Efficient Solar Panel of Icosahedron-based Hemispherical Dome)

  • 손수덕;이돈우;이승재
    • 한국공간구조학회논문집
    • /
    • 제16권1호
    • /
    • pp.53-64
    • /
    • 2016
  • Solar power is being spotlighted recently as a new energy source due to environmental problems and applications of solar power to curved structures are increasing. Solar panels installed on curved surfaces have different efficiencies depending on its position and the efficient positioning of solar panels plays a critical role in the design of solar power generation systems. In this study, the changing characteristics of solar irradiance were analyzed for hemispherical dome with a large curvature and the positioning of solar panels that can efficiently utilize solar energy was investigated. With an icosahedron-based hemispherical dome consisting of triangular elements as target model, a program for calculating solar irradiance using a normal vector of the solar module on each face was developed. Furthermore, the change of solar irradiance according to the sun's path was analyzed by time and season, and its effects on shades were also examined. From the analysis results, the effective positioning could be determined on the basis of the efficiency of the solar panels installed on the dome surfaces on solar irradiance.

ON REGULAR POLYGONS AND REGULAR SOLIDS HAVING INTEGER COORDINATES FOR THEIR VERTICES

  • Jang, Changrim
    • East Asian mathematical journal
    • /
    • 제30권3호
    • /
    • pp.303-310
    • /
    • 2014
  • We study the existence of regular polygons and regular solids whose vertices have integer coordinates in the three dimensional space and study side lengths of such squares, cubes and tetrahedra. We show that except for equilateral triangles, squares and regular hexagons there is no regular polygon whose vertices have integer coordinates. By using this, we show that there is no regular icosahedron and no regular dodecahedron whose vertices have integer coordinates. We characterize side lengths of such squares and cubes. In addition to these results, we prove Ionascu's result [4, Theorem2.2] that every equilateral triangle of side length $\sqrt{2}m$ for a positive integer m whose vertices have integer coordinate can be a face of a regular tetrahedron with vertices having integer coordinates in a different way.

Detection of Adenovirus from Respiratory and Alimentary Tract in Pusan, 1999

  • Cho, Kyung-Soon;Kim, Young-Hee
    • Journal of Life Science
    • /
    • 제10권2호
    • /
    • pp.17-20
    • /
    • 2000
  • Adenovirus which is an important infectious viral agent in respiratory and alimentary tract was investigated in Pusan, 1999. Fifteen cases of adenovirus were detected from stools and throat swabs of suspected patients. Two cases of enteric adenovirus were detected from a 5 years old boy and a 6-month-old boy. Thirteen cases of respiratory adenoviruses were detected from children aged under 10 years old and one adult. From respiratory specimens, 1 case of adenovirus type 2, 1 case of type 5, and 11 cases of type 3 were found. Enterotype 41 was detected from fecal preparations. Adenoviruses appeared mostly during winter months, January, February and December. Adenovirus showed a slowly progressive cytopathic effect on HEp-2 cells, Vero cells and BGM cells at 37$^{\circ}C$, in a 5-7% $CO_{2}$ incubation. An electron microscopic observation exhibited non-enveloped icosahedron with a diameter of 70nm. No significant differences on cytopathic effect and morphological features have been found from specimens of either alimentary tract or respiratory secretions.

입체도형에 대한 $6{\sim}7$학년 수학영재들의 공간시각화 능력 분석 (Analysis of the Mathematically Gifted 6th and 7th Graders' Spatial Visualization Ability of Solid Figures)

  • 류현아;정영옥;송상헌
    • 대한수학교육학회지:학교수학
    • /
    • 제9권2호
    • /
    • pp.277-289
    • /
    • 2007
  • 본 연구는 수학영재들의 공간 시각화 능력을 살펴보는데 그 목적이 있다. 연구 대상은 국가가 지원하는 대학부설 과학영재교육원에서 교육을 받고 있는 초등학교 6학년 6명과 중학교 1학년 1명으로, 각 학생들에게 정이십면체의 겨냥도에서 각 변과 모서리들의 길이, 변과 모서리들이 이루는 각도들을 비교하는 과제를 제시하여 그들이 해결하는 과정에서 드러나는 공간 시각화 능력을 질적인 방법으로 분석하였다. 이 때 자료 분석은 McGee의 공간 시각화 능력을 중심으로 Duval과 Del Grand의 이론을 참조하였다. 분석 결과, 수학영재학생들은 윤곽을 시각화하는 능력, 상상 속에서 대상을 조작하는 능력, 묘사된 대상의 회전을 상상하는 능력, 묘사된 대상을 다른 형태로 변형하는 능력을 보이는 보였으며, 일부 수학영재학생들은 평면에 묘사된 대상을 다시 입체로 상상해 내고 이를 표현해내는 데 다소 어려움을 겪고 있다는 것을 알 수 있었다.

Synthesis of Synchrotron Radiation-induced Gold Nanoparticles as Radiosensitizer in Radiotherapy

  • Oh, Se An;Park, Jae Won;Kim, Seong Hoon;Kim, Sung Kyu;Yea, Ji Woon;Lee, Su Yong;Kang, Hyon Chol
    • Journal of the Korean Physical Society
    • /
    • 제73권11호
    • /
    • pp.1744-1749
    • /
    • 2018
  • This study investigated the feasibility of synthesizing GNPs using synchrotron radiation X-ray for use as a radiosensitizer in radiotherapy, and examined the morphology of the GNPs. Different concentration ratios of 4-mM gold precursor aqueous solution and 4-mM $NaHCO_3$ were mixed. This gold precursor aqueous solution was continuously irradiated with synchrotron radiation in the 4B X-ray microdiffraction beamline of Pohang Light Source (PLS)-II in Korea. The SEM, EDS, TEM, and XRD spectra of the GNPs synthesized using the synchrotron radiation were investigated. The GNPs synthesized using the synchrotron radiation were nanocrystals predominantly in the (111) direction of the face-centered cubic structure. We found that the shape of the gold nanoparticles was icosahedron at the molar concentrations of 0.25 mM:0.25 mM and 0.5 mM:0.5 mM mixed with 4 mM $HAuCl_4{\cdot}3H_2O$ and 4 mM $NaHCO_3$ solutions.
